You were a girl in the 1970s if you:

•Had that Fisher Price Doctor's Kit with a stethoscope that actually worked.

•Owned a bicycle with a banana seat and a plastic basket with flowers on it.

•Learned to skate with actual skates (not roller blades)that had metal wheels.

•Thought Gopher from Love Boat was cute. (It’s okay to admit it, you know…)

•Sported either a "bowl" or "pixie" cut, not to mention the "Dorothy Hamill.” (Did people sometimes think you were a boy?)

•Wore rubber boots for rainy days and Moon boots for snowy days.

•Played on a "Slip-n-Slide," on which you injured yourself on a sprinkler head more than once.

•Thought your Holly Hobbie sleeping bag was your most prized possession.

•Wore a poncho, gauchos, and knickers.

•Hoped Santa would bring you the electronic game, Simon.

•Played with the Donnie and Marie dolls with those pink and purple satin shredded outfits. Or possible you had the Sonny and Cher dolls?

•Spent hours in your backyard on your metal swing set with the trapeze. The swing set tipped over at least once.

•Wore homemade ribbon barrettes in every imaginable color.

•Wanted to be Laura Ingalls Wilder really, really bad. You wore that Little House on the Prairie-inspired plaid, ruffle shirt with the high neck in at least one school picture...and you despised Nellie Oleson!

•Dreamed your first kiss to be at a roller rink!

• Thought PONG! ("video tennis") was the most remarkable futuristic game you ever saw!

•Had a hairstyle with "wings" or "feathers" and you kept it "pretty" with the comb you kept in your back pocket. When you walked, the "wings" flapped up and down, like you were going to “take flight.”

•Know who Strawberry Shortcake is, as well as her friends, Blueberry Muffin and Huckleberry Pie.

•Carried a Muppets lunch box to school and it was metal - not plastic - with the thermos inside. Some were glass inside and broke the first time you dropped them.

•Fought with your girlfriends over which of the Dukes of Hazzard was your boyfriend.

•Had Star Wars action figures!

•Asked your Magic-8 ball the question: "Who will I marry… Shaun Cassidy, Leif Garrett,David Cassidy, or Andy Gibb?"

•Wore out your Grease, Saturday Night Fever, and FAME soundtrack record albums.

•Tried to do lots of arts and crafts, like yarn and Popsicle-stick God's eyes, decoupage, or those funky potholders made on a plastic loom.

•Cooked Shrinky-Dinks.

•Taped songs off the radio by holding your portable tape player up to the speaker.

•Had subscriptions to Dynamite and Tiger Beat.

•Learned everything you needed to know about girl issues from Judy Blume books.

•Thought Olivia Newton John's song "Physical" was actually about aerobics.

•Wore friendship pins on your Nike tennis shoes, or shoelaces with heart or rainbow designs.

•Drowned yourself in Love's Baby Soft - which was the first "real" perfume you ever owned.

…And most importantly, you wanted to be a Solid Gold dancer.
